My motor is an 05 car engine, (I’ve swapped to the later coils/valve covers for looks)
Mine has had cam and long tubes with 6.1 valvesprings and pushrods since I first fired it up 4 years ago. It now has Eagle heads and 6.1 intake...

Even with the cam/longtubes it still ran out of power about 5600... I drive it about 1k a year, and race is 4-5 times a year, and drive like a goon pretty frequently when it’s out. I have my limiter set at 6300, and have had it bump off the limiter more than a few times when my auto trans occasionally decides to hold 2nd too long...

Long story short, I agree with these guys if it’s a well maintained motor you’ll be fine running it as is. With the cam just be sure you do springs to match. I wouldn’t worry about forged internals if you’re building a regular street car. Keep the AFRs and timing safe and you’ll be fine... Add boost or nitrous and then I’d worry.
